Over the past six years, we have received encouraging reports from Ecuador, where a conductor called  Dante Santiago Anzolini has been giving national premieres of two Mahler symphonies, Stravinsky’s Rite of Spring and Firebird, Berio’s Rendering, Bartok’s Music for Strings percussion and celeste and much else. He has also exhumed the works of Ecuador’s national composer Luis Salgado.

However, all this counts for nothing when politicians get involved.

Ecuador has had six Minister of Culture in as many years and each of them has a God-given right to meddle with the orchestra. The latest is called María Elena Machuca.

The Orquesta Sinfónica de Guayaquil, has had five executive directors over that period. The latest, Ana María Tamayo, has fired the orchestra’s music director for no apparent cause. No word of the putsch has been published on the orchestra’s website.

Ms Tamayo spends much of her time on Instagram and Facebook under an assumed name (below). Meanwhile, the music dies.
